Subsonic radiation waves. Comparison of the theory with experiment

Description
The experimental results on the propagation (in air) of plane plasma fronts of absorption of neodymium and CO2 laser radiations are compared with numerical calculations carried out using a theory of plane laminar subsonic radiation waves and making a detailed allowance for the spectral and angular distributions of the radiation. The agreement between the theory and experiment is good, at least far from the optical detonation threshold
